How should a lifter present themselves to the referees at the start of their lift?

Lifters must present themselves in a respectful manner to the referees at the start of their lift because it reflects the seriousness and integrity of the competition. This respect is part of maintaining the sport's professionalism and ensuring that all participants honor the rules and the judging process.

Showing respect to the referees also helps create a positive atmosphere and fosters a good relationship between competitors and officials, which is essential for the smooth conduct of the event. It emphasizes the lifter's commitment to the sport and their understanding of the formality surrounding their performance.
